Following the FIA hearing in Paris on Tuesday, April 14, the court of appeal confirmed that the Brawn GP BGP 001 was perfectly in compliance with the technical regulations. Ross Brawn, director of the Brawn GP team, stated: “We are satisfied with the decision made by the international court of appeal today. We respect our […]

The FIA Court of Appeal met yesterday in Paris to study the appeal of Ferrari, Red Bull, and Renault following the decision made by the stewards’ sporting committee in Melbourne on March 26th. These three teams had lodged protests and contended that Brawn GP, Toyota, and Williams were not complying with the 2009 technical regulations. […]
